Per ESPN, by millions:
Big Ten: $242
SEC: $205
Big 12: $78
ACC: $67
Pac 10: $58
Big East: $33
http://news.collegesportsinfo.com/2009/12/2009-college-sports-tv-revenue-by.html
The Big 12's TV deals aren't up for renewal until 2016, while the Pac 10's contract expires after the 2011-2012 academic year.
